Visual Basic - sumar con ciclo

Life is soft - evento anual de software empresarial
   
Vista:

sumar con ciclo

Publicado por Ana Guadalupe Hernández Vilchis (2 intervenciones) el 09/10/2013 23:21:17
Debo realizar un programa que acumula los sueldos de 10 trabajadores, los suelos se leen en una caja de texto utilizando un ciclo for pero no acumula cada sueldo en la variable correspondiente se utiliza un botón para leer cada valor y se debería imprimir la suma después del ciclo
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

sumar con ciclo

Publicado por Juan Gilberto (277 intervenciones) el 10/10/2013 18:16:50
Si publicas el codigo que utilizas, te puedo ayudar a resolver tu problema
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

sumar con ciclo

Publicado por Ana Guadalupe Hernández Vilchis (2 intervenciones) el 13/10/2013 01:12:00
Asi si lo acumula pero acumula cada valor 10 veces se recibe el dato en un cuadro de texto y se pasa a la variable con el botón capturar y con el de capturar se despliega el total
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
For I = 1 To 10 Step 1
S = Text1.Text ' se lee salario en caja de texto1
T = S + T 'se suma el salario
Label3 = T ' desplegar el valor del total
Next I
End Sub
 
 
 
Private Sub Form_Load()
T = 0 'inicializar T
End Sub
 
 
 
Private Sub salario_Click()
Label2 = "Total " & T ' desplegar T
 
End Sub
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

sumar con ciclo

Publicado por Juan Gilberto (277 intervenciones) el 13/10/2013 16:40:37
Acumulas cada valor 10 veces porque asi lo estas estableciendo al utilizar el For-Next loop

Aqui la pregunta importante es : Donde estan tus 10 trabajadores?
1 Estan en algun archivo?
2 Los vas capturando uno a la vez y quieres sumar su Sueldo de cada uno cada vez que capturas un trabajador?
3 Si es otra tu respuesta,explica...
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ar